All is now set for the 2023 Igbo Day which is scheduled to hold in Ottawa, Canada, from 5pm, to 12midnight on Saturday, July 29, 2023.

The event, which is being packaged by Igbos resident in Canada, especially those in Ottawa-Gatinueau is expected to be graced by creme la creme of the Igbo community in Canada and beyond.

A release issued to that effect, indicates that the event which will hold at Ron Kolbus Lake side Center, 102 Greenview Ave, Ottawa, Ontario, K2B 8JB, will feature Igbo cuisines, traditional dances, fund raising and other side attractions. The release also stated that the event is open for sponsorship and advertisement.

In a separate development,an offshoot of the Igbo community in Canada under the auspices of JOPET and friends  in Ottawa  have expressed their preparedness for the forthcoming event.

Speaking with this Reporter in Canada over the week,an elder statesman who is one of the founding members of the group, Chief Chuks Jacob  who traced the history of JOPET  and FREINDS which is also known as Onyeaghala nwanne ya grouo narrated that the group  started sometime during the Covid-19 pandemic as an association formed to promote the collective interests of Igbos resident in Ottawa. But gradually and by virtue of the love and patriotism of it’s members and their willingness to foster unity, the group has metamorphosed into a vibrant and strong purpose driven pro-Igbo group.

He further spoke on their commitment to  continuously showcase the rich cultural and traditional heritage of Igbos and Nigeria at large,adding that the group will, in no distant time become a reference point by virtue of its people-oriented programs and ideology.
